-- viewing nowThe Professional Certificate in Supporting LGBTQ+ Clients in Speech Therapy is a crucial course for healthcare professionals seeking to provide inclusive and respectful care. This certificate course highlights the unique communication challenges faced by the LGBTQ+ community and equips learners with the essential skills to address these issues effectively.

Course details
• Understanding Gender Identity and Expression in Speech Therapy
• Communication Disorders in Transgender and Gender Non-Conforming Clients
• Addressing Sexuality and Sexual Health Communication Needs
• Culturally Responsive Therapy for LGBTQ+ Clients
• Working with LGBTQ+ Youth and Families
• Ethical Considerations in LGBTQ+ Affirmative Care
• Intersectionality and LGBTQ+ Identities
